About

Dr. Živana Cvijan Stevančević is a seasoned radiologist specializing in pediatric imaging, with an impressive 35 years of experience at Serbia’s largest children’s clinic – the University Children’s Clinic in Belgrade. She is proficient in general pediatric radiology, which includes the use of conventional X-ray techniques, ultrasound, CT scans, and MRI.
Dr. Stevančević is skilled in reading and interpreting radiological images, which are often crucial for accurate diagnosis and effective treatment. At Sava Memorial Hospital, she leads the pediatric diagnostic department, conducting ultrasound examinations of the heart, abdominal organs, endocrine glands, kidneys, urinary system, and musculoskeletal system.
Since 2005, Dr. Stevančević has been teaching at the School of Ultrasound Application in Pediatric Radiology at the University Children’s Clinic. Throughout her career, she has continually advanced her expertise through educational programs organized by European associations of radiologists and pediatric radiologists. She has authored and co-authored many published articles in the fields of pediatric radiology, neuroradiology, oncology, and gastroenterology.

Professional philosophy and approach to patient care:

“In pediatrics, our relationship as doctors is often essentially with our patient’s parents. Of course, it’s important for us to communicate with the child, but it’s almost equally vital to establish a trusting relationship with the parents. Illness and hospital stays are always a significant stress for the family of a young child. Over the years, I’ve seen both parents and children struggle through these times. However, I’ve also witnessed how much it helps them to have trust in their doctor.”
